Coat of arms of Princes Tserreteli

The House of Tsereteli (Georgian: წერეთელი), also known as Tsertelev (Russian), is a noble family in Georgia (and partly, a Russian noble family) which gave origin to several notable writers, politicians, scholars, and artists.
